Typhoon strikes China

ONE of the strongest typhoons in years has lifted waves taller than lampposts on to Hong Kong promenades and created rough seas on the southern Chinese coast after causing deadly destruction in Taiwan and the Philippines.

In Taiwan, 17 people died in a flooded town, and 10 deaths were reported in the Philippines.

Nearly 1.9 million people were relocated across the province of Guangdong, the southern Chinese economic powerhouse.

A weather station in Chuandao recorded maximum gusts of about 150mph at noon yesterday, a high in Jiangmen city since recordkeeping began.

Huge waves battered the city of Zhuhai's coastline and strong winds buffeted trees under intense rain. Fallen branches were scattered on the streets.
